/* WEB SITE - INSTITUTO ÍRIS */
/* AUTOR - RODRIGO VERA SANCHES - VULCANO M´DIA DIGITAL */

body {margin: 5px 0px 0px 0px; background-image:url(../imagens/back.gif);}


p {	font-family:Arial, Helvetica, sans-serif; font-size: 11px; color: #666666; margin-top: 0px; line-height: 16px;
	margin-bottom: 11px;}

p a {font-family:Arial, Helvetica, sans-serif; font-size: 11px; color:#8425d2; margin-top: 0px; text-decoration:underline}
	
p a:hover { font-family:Arial, Helvetica, sans-serif; font-size: 11px; color:#8425d2; margin-top: 0px; text-decoration:none}


li {font-family:Arial, Helvetica, sans-serif; font-size: 12px; color: #666666; margin-top: 0px; line-height: 20px;	margin-bottom: 11px; list-style:disc;}

li a {font-family:Arial, Helvetica, sans-serif; font-size: 12px; color:#8425d2; margin-top: 0px; line-height: 20px;	margin-bottom: 11px; list-style:disc;}

	
.formu {margin-top:5px; font:Arial, Helvetica, sans-serif; font-size:10px;}

h1 {font-family:Georgia, "Times New Roman", Times, serif; font-size:28px; color:#0b427a; margin-bottom:10px; font-weight:200;}

h2 {font-family:Georgia, "Times New Roman", Times, serif; font-size:22px; color:#0b427a; margin-bottom:5px; font-weight:200;}
h2 a {font-family:Georgia, "Times New Roman", Times, serif; font-size:22px; color:#0b427a; margin-bottom:5px; font-weight:200; text-decoration:none;}
h2 a:hover {font-family:Georgia, "Times New Roman", Times, serif; font-size:22px; color:#0b427a; margin-bottom:5px; font-weight:200; text-decoration:none;}

h3 {font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; color:#0b427a; margin-bottom:5px; font-weight:100;}

h4 {font-family:Georgia, "Times New Roman", Times, serif; font-size:11px; color:#0b427a; margin-bottom:5px; font-weight:bold;}




h6 {	font-family:Arial, Helvetica, sans-serif; font-size: 9px; color: #666666; margin-top: 0px; line-height: 16px;
	margin-bottom: 11px;}
h6 a {font-family:Arial, Helvetica, sans-serif; font-size: 9px; color:#8425d2; margin-top: 0px; text-decoration:underline}	
h6 a:hover { font-family:Arial, Helvetica, sans-serif; font-size: 9px; color:#8425d2; margin-top: 0px; text-decoration:none}


address { font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#45649d; font-style:normal;}

b { font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#666666;}

#total { width:820px; margin-left:auto; margin-right:auto; clear:both;}

#topo {width:802px; float:left; height:auto;}



#barra {width:680px; height:26px; background-image:url(../imagens/bck_barra.gif); background-repeat:no-repeat; margin-top:4px; float:left; padding-left:140px; padding-top:1px;}

#barra ul {list-style:none; margin-top:2px; margin-left:55px;}

#barra ul li { display:inline; font-family:Georgia, "Times New Roman", Times, serif; color:#FFFFFF; font-size:13px; margin-right:0px; float:none;}

#barra ul li a { color:#FFFFFF; text-decoration:none; margin-right:40px;}

#barra ul li a:hover {text-decoration:underline; color:#00FF00;}




#menu {width:150px; float:left; margin-left:30px; background-color:#e4f6ea; background-image:url(../imagens/back_menu.jpg); background-repeat:no-repeat; display:inline; height:auto;}

#menu2 {width:150px;}

#menu2 p { font-family: Georgia, "Times New Roman", Times, serif; color:#8258a4; font-size:16px; line-height:58px; margin-left:11px; margin-bottom:25px;}

#menu2 p a {
	font-family: Georgia, "Times New Roman", Times, serif;
	color:#8258a4;
	font-size:16px;
	line-height:45px;
	margin-left:11px;
	margin-bottom:25px;
	text-decoration:none;
}

#menu2 p a:hover { font-family: Georgia, "Times New Roman", Times, serif; color:#00FF00; font-size:16px; line-height:58px; margin-left:11px; margin-bottom:25px; text-decoration:none;}

#menu2 ul { padding:0px; margin-left:10px;}
#menu2 li { font-family: Georgia, "Times New Roman", Times, serif; color:#8258a4; font-size:18px; line-height:25px; margin-bottom:5px; list-style:none;}
#menu2 li a { font-family: Georgia, "Times New Roman", Times, serif; color:#8258a4; font-size:18px; text-decoration:none;}
#menu2 li a:hover { font-family: Georgia, "Times New Roman", Times, serif; color:#03d4d6; font-size:18px; text-decoration:none;}



#menu3 {width:auto; height:auto; float:left; margin-left:10px;}
#menu3 ul { padding:0px; margin-left:10px;}
#menu3 li { font-family: Georgia, "Times New Roman", Times, serif; color:#8258a4; font-size:16px; line-height:25px; margin-bottom:18px; list-style:none;}
#menu3 li a { font-family: Georgia, "Times New Roman", Times, serif; color:#8258a4; font-size:16px; text-decoration:none;}
#menu3 li a:hover { font-family: Georgia, "Times New Roman", Times, serif; color:#8258a4; font-size:16px; text-decoration:none;}


#assinatura {width:130px; margin-left:3px; padding:5px; border:#e8f7f0 solid 1px; background-color:#f5faf7;}



#cont_home {width:512px; height:110px; background-image: url(../imagens/back_logo.jpg); background-repeat:no-repeat; float:left; padding-top:10px; padding-right:100px;}

#cont_vitalite {width:273px; height:285px; float:left; background-image:url(../imagens/back_vitalite.jpg); background-repeat:no-repeat; margin-left:5px; padding-left:15px; padding-right:10px; padding-top:10px;}

#cont_spadental {width:275px; height:299px; float:left; background-image:url(../imagens/back_spa_dental.jpg); background-repeat:no-repeat; margin-left:5px; padding-right:15px; padding-left:15px;}

#cont_artigos {width:270px; height:205px; float:left; background-image:url(../imagens/back_artigos.jpg); background-repeat:no-repeat; margin-left:5px; padding-right:15px; padding-left:15px; margin-top:3px; padding-top:1px;}

#indice { width:264px; height:110px; overflow:auto; border:#f8ecff solid 1px;}

#cont_outros {width:270px; height:205px; float:left; background-image:url(../imagens/back_artigos.jpg); background-repeat:no-repeat; margin-left:5px; padding-right:15px; padding-left:15px; margin-top:3px; padding-top:1px;}

#rodape {
	margin: 0px auto 20px auto;
	width:802px;
	height:100px;
	clear:both;
	background-image:url(../imagens/back_rodape.jpg);
	background-repeat:no-repeat;
	padding-top:5px;
}


#cont_geral {width:590px; height:auto; padding:2px 15px 15px 15px; float:left; background-image:url(../imagens/back_geral.jpg); background-repeat:no-repeat;}


#cont_terapias {width:590px; height:445px; padding:20px 15px 15px 15px; float:left; background-image:url(../imagens/back_terapias.jpg); background-repeat:no-repeat;}

#cont_terapias h1 {margin-top:0px;}

#cont_terapias p {font-size:12px;}

#cont_terapias p a {font-size:12px;}

#cont_terapias p a:hover {font-size:12px;}


#foto_terapia {width:187px; height:212px; float:left; padding-left:3px;}

#menu_terapias {width:560px; height:135px; float:left; margin-left:10px; margin-top:10px; display:inline;}

#menu_terapias p { font-size:12px; line-height:22px; margin-top:-3px;}


#terapia_base {width:365px; height:200px; padding:5px; float:left;}



#mapa {width:250px; height:250px;}



#cont_geral p {font-size: 12px; line-height: 22px;}

#cont_geral p a {font-size: 12px; line-height: 22px;}
	
#cont_geral p a:hover {font-size: 12px; line-height: 22px;}

#imagem1 {float:left; width:auto; height:auto; margin:10px 10px 10px 0px;}

#imagem2 {float:left; width:auto; height:auto; margin:10px 10px 10px 0px;}

#imagem3 {float:left; width:auto; height:auto; margin:10px 10px 10px 0px;}

#imagem4 {float:left; width:auto; height:auto; margin:10px 10px 10px 0px;}

#imagem5 {float:left; width:auto; height:auto; margin:10px 10px 10px 0px;}
	
#cont_spa {width:550px; height:auto; padding:10px 15px 15px 15px; float:left; background-color:#f2f9f4;}

#pop_ups {width:260px; height:320px; overflow:auto; padding:15px;}



/*VIDEOS*/
#video {width:185px;float:left;padding:5px; text-align:center;}
